]> git.ipfire.org Git - thirdparty/sqlalchemy/sqlalchemy.git/commitdiff
added explicit "convert date types to a string in bind params", since pysqlite1 doesn...
authorMike Bayer <mike_mp@zzzcomputing.com>
Thu, 23 Mar 2006 07:38:28 +0000 (07:38 +0000)
committerMike Bayer <mike_mp@zzzcomputing.com>
Thu, 23 Mar 2006 07:38:28 +0000 (07:38 +0000)
lib/sqlalchemy/databases/sqlite.py

index ffa7c1bd450a1416c9a46a97cba1ff65f338944e..0e208854e3f91d9ee530d4e8387c3ecafb4da747 100644 (file)
@@ -38,6 +38,11 @@ class SLSmallInteger(sqltypes.Smallinteger):
 class SLDateTime(sqltypes.DateTime):
     def get_col_spec(self):
         return "TIMESTAMP"
+    def convert_bind_param(self, value, engine):
+        if value is not None:
+            return str(value)
+        else:
+            return None
     def _cvt(self, value, engine, fmt):
         if value is None:
             return None